Software Development Engineer for Next-Generation Products

2 days ago


Hazelwood, Missouri, United States Actalent Full time

About Actalent

Actalent is a global leader in engineering and sciences services and talent solutions, driving scale, innovation, and speed to market for visionary companies.

Our network of almost 30,000 consultants and more than 4,500 clients across the U.S., Canada, Asia, and Europe serves many of the Fortune 500.

Job Overview

We are seeking a skilled Software Development Engineer to join our team and contribute to the development and extension of next-generation products.

Responsibilities

The successful candidate will be responsible for developing and maintaining software for training and simulation products, implementing rendering, shading, lighting, load balancing, weather effects, and animation features, and working on multi-threading, anti-aliasing, dynamic paging, and display interfaces.

Requirements

To be successful in this role, you will need:

  • Proficiency in C++ programming
  • Experience with Unreal Engine technology and game design
  • Minimum of 5 years of Unreal Engine developer experience
  • Strong object-oriented programming skills
  • Familiarity with Unity and software engineering principles

Additional Skills

The ideal candidate will also have:

  • Strong mathematics capability – matrix algebra, projective geometry, vector math, etc.
  • Experience with game development
  • Knowledge of STL and/or Boost libraries and data structures
  • Experience with design patterns and/or multi-threading
  • Proficiency in MS Visual Studio

Work Environment

This role can be based either on-site in Hazelwood, MO or remote, and will be part of a collaborative and innovative team.

Compensation

The estimated annual salary for this role is $120,000 - $180,000, depending on experience and qualifications.

Benefits

At Actalent, we offer a comprehensive benefits package, including medical, dental, and vision insurance, 401(k) matching, and paid time off.

About Us

Actalent is an equal opportunity employer and welcomes applications from diverse candidates. We are committed to creating an inclusive environment and fostering a culture of care, engagement, and recognition.

How to Apply

If you are a motivated and experienced software developer looking to join a dynamic team, please submit your application for this exciting opportunity.



  • Hazelwood, Missouri, United States BioFire Diagnostics Full time

    Software Development EngineerWe are seeking a highly skilled Software Development Engineer to join our team at BioFire Diagnostics. As a key member of our software development team, you will be responsible for designing, developing, and testing software applications that support patient health and consumer product safety.Key Responsibilities:Design and...


  • Hazelwood, Missouri, United States BioFire Diagnostics Full time

    Job Summary:We are seeking a highly skilled Software Engineer to join our team at BioFire Diagnostics. As a key member of our software development team, you will be responsible for designing, developing, and maintaining software applications that support patient health and consumer product safety.Key Responsibilities:• Develop high-quality software...

  • Software Developer

    4 weeks ago


    Hazelwood, Missouri, United States The Judge Group Full time

    Job Title: Software EngineerWe are seeking a highly skilled Software Engineer to join our team at The Judge Group.Job Summary:The successful candidate will be responsible for designing, developing, and maintaining software systems, as well as collaborating with the software development team to share expertise and knowledge.Key Responsibilities:Develop and...


  • Hazelwood, Missouri, United States BioFire Diagnostics, LLC. Full time

    Software Development Opportunities:At BioFire Diagnostics, LLC., we are seeking a skilled Software Development Engineer to join our team. As a key member of our software development team, you will be responsible for designing, developing, and maintaining high-quality software applications that meet the needs of our customers.Key Responsibilities: Design and...

  • Software Engineer

    2 months ago


    Hazelwood, Missouri, United States Boeing Full time

    Job DescriptionJob SummaryWe are seeking a highly skilled Software Engineer - Flight Simulator Development to join our team at Boeing. As a key member of our Training Systems - Battlespace Simulation Management team, you will play a critical role in the design, development, and maintenance of flight simulators for military and commercial aircraft.Key...


  • Hazelwood, Missouri, United States BioFire Diagnostics Full time

    Software Development RoleWe are seeking a skilled Software Development Specialist to join our team at BioFire Diagnostics. As a key member of our software development team, you will be responsible for designing, developing, and maintaining high-quality software applications that meet the needs of our customers.Key ResponsibilitiesDesign and develop software...

  • Software Developer

    1 month ago


    Hazelwood, Missouri, United States The Judge Group Full time

    Software EngineerThe Judge Group is seeking a highly skilled Software Engineer to join our team in developing and maintaining the Tomahawk Missile Mission Planning (TMP) system.Key Responsibilities:Design, develop, and test software components for the TMP system.Collaborate with the software development team to share expertise and knowledge.Develop software...

  • Software Developer

    1 month ago


    Hazelwood, Missouri, United States The Judge Group Full time

    Job Title: Software EngineerWe are seeking a highly skilled Software Engineer to join our team at The Judge Group.Job Summary:The successful candidate will be responsible for developing, documenting, and maintaining software systems, as well as collaborating with the software development team to share expertise and knowledge.Key Responsibilities:Develop and...

  • Software Developer

    2 weeks ago


    Hazelwood, Missouri, United States The Judge Group Full time

    Software Engineer - TMPMUST have active Top Secret clearance.The TMP program provides the US Navy with Innovative, Modernization and Maintenance software releases supporting Tomahawk Missile Mission Planning. As a key member of our team, you will be responsible for all aspects of TMP lifecycle software development.Key Responsibilities:Develop and maintain...


  • Hazelwood, Missouri, United States Boeing Full time

    Job DescriptionJob SummaryBoeing is seeking a skilled Senior Software Engineer to join our Training Systems - Battlespace Simulation Management team in Hazelwood, Missouri. This position will focus on supporting the Boeing Global Services (BGS) business organization.Key ResponsibilitiesDevelop and maintain software architectures, requirements, algorithms,...

  • Software Engineer

    2 weeks ago


    Hazelwood, Missouri, United States Boeing Full time

    Job Title: Software EngineerWe are seeking a skilled Software Engineer to join our team at Boeing. As a Software Engineer, you will play a crucial role in the design, development, testing, and maintenance of non-embedded software throughout the end-to-end lifecycle that meets industry, customer, and safety standards for the Tomahawk program.Key...


  • Hazelwood, Missouri, United States Randstad Full time

    Job Title: Software DevSecOps EngineerWe are seeking a highly skilled Software DevSecOps Engineer to join our team at Randstad Digital. As a DevSecOps Engineer, you will be responsible for ensuring the security and integrity of our software development lifecycle.Key Responsibilities:Harden infrastructure for development and production environmentsBuild and...

  • Software Developer

    1 week ago


    Hazelwood, Missouri, United States The Boeing Company Full time

    Job DescriptionAt The Boeing Company, we are committed to innovation and collaboration to make the world a better place. Our team is dedicated to designing, implementing, training, and supporting logistics information systems with over 30 years of industry experience.We are seeking a talented Software Engineer – Developer to join our team in Hazelwood,...


  • Hazelwood, Missouri, United States Boeing Full time

    Job DescriptionBoeing is seeking a skilled Mid-Level Software Engineer to join our team in Hazelwood, Missouri. As a member of our Training Systems - Battlespace Simulation Management team, you will play a critical role in supporting the Boeing Global Services (BGS) business organization.Key Responsibilities:Develop and maintain software systems, including...


  • Hazelwood, Missouri, United States Chipton-Ross Inc. Full time

    Job Title: Test and Verification Software EngineerChipton-Ross is seeking a skilled Test and Verification Software Engineer to join our team in Hazelwood, MO.Job Summary:The successful candidate will play a crucial role in the design, development, and completion of test and verification of software products to ensure quality, reliability, and functionality...


  • Hazelwood, Missouri, United States Chipton-Ross Full time

    Job Title: Software Engineer DevSecOps SpecialistChipton-Ross is seeking a highly skilled Software Engineer DevSecOps Specialist to join our team in Hazelwood, MO.Job Summary:We are looking for a talented DevSecOps engineer to support the development and verification of the Tomahawk Mission Planning (TMP) System. The successful candidate will be responsible...


  • Hazelwood, Missouri, United States HonorVet Technologies Full time

    Job Title: Associate Electrical EngineerJob Summary: We are seeking an Associate Electrical Engineer to support and sustain Instrument Manufacturing activities and facilitate efficient operations within the production environment. The successful candidate will assist in all aspects of electronic design, from the initial feasibility stage to manufacturing...


  • Hazelwood, Missouri, United States HonorVet Technologies Full time

    Job Title: Associate Electrical EngineerJob Summary:At HonorVet Technologies, we are seeking a highly skilled Associate Electrical Engineer to support and sustain Instrument Manufacturing activities and facilitate efficient operations within the production environment.Key Responsibilities:• Assist in all aspects of electronic design, from the initial...


  • Hazelwood, Missouri, United States Chipton-Ross Full time

    Real-Time Software Engineer OpportunityChipton-Ross is seeking highly skilled Real-Time Software Engineers to join our team in Hazelwood, MO.Responsibilities:Develop and maintain code for the Tomahawk Missile Mission Planning (TMP) system.Collaborate with the software development team to share expertise and knowledge.Implement software processes, tools, and...


  • Hazelwood, Missouri, United States Chipton-Ross Full time

    {"Responsibilities": "As a Test and Verification Software Engineer 3, you will play a crucial role in the design, development, and completion of test and verification of software products to ensure quality, reliability, and functionality for the Tomahawk program, while adhering to strict government regulations. You will have the opportunity to partner with...